What is a Cryptocurrency Casino?

At its core, a cryptocurrency casino is an online gambling platform that accepts digital possessions-- such as Bitcoin (BTC), Ethereum (ETH), Litecoin (LTC), or stablecoins (GBPT)-- as a primary approach for deposits, withdrawals, and game wagering.

Unlike conventional platforms that count on centralized banking systems, credit cards, or e-wallets, crypto gambling establishments use blockchain innovation to assist in transactions. This architecture eliminates a number of the friction points related to traditional banking, such as lengthy confirmation processes, high transaction charges, and geographic limitations.

The Core Advantages of Crypto Gaming

Why are millions of users moving to crypto gambling establishments? The response depends on the distinct utility of blockchain innovation.

1. Provably Fair Gaming

Among the most significant developments in the crypto casino space is the "Provably Fair" algorithm. In a traditional casino, gamers should rely on the operator to confirm that the video game outcome is random. In a crypto casino, the video game reasoning is often written on a wise contract. Players can individually verify the hash of the round to ensure that the result was not manipulated. This cryptographic certainty develops a level of trust that traditional "black box" algorithms can not replicate.

2. International Accessibility

Traditional online betting is often impeded by stiff banking regulations and anti-money laundering (AML) laws that prevent cross-border deals. Since cryptocurrency operates on decentralized networks, it bypasses these hurdles. For users in regions with restricted access to international banking, crypto gambling establishments represent a substantial entrance to digital home entertainment.

3. Financial Efficiency

Conventional banking institutions often charge considerable charges for currency conversion and international processing. Crypto deals, especially on networks like Solana or Tron, sustain negligible charges. In addition, the withdrawal process-- which can take days by means of a bank wire-- is minimized to minutes, as deals are processed instantly by the blockchain.

Prospective Risks and Considerations

While the benefits are compelling, involvement in crypto gambling is not without its dangers. It is necessary to approach this space with a high degree of digital literacy.

1. Market Volatility

The worth of cryptocurrencies can swing extremely within hours. A player might win a significant amount in Bitcoin, just to see the worth of those payouts come by 10% before they have the opportunity to withdraw or trade them into a stablecoin.

2. Irreversibility of Transactions

Blockchain transactions are immutable. If a user gets in the incorrect wallet address during a withdrawal, that capital is permanently lost. Unlike a charge card transaction, there is no "chargeback" feature or client service department that can reverse a blockchain transfer.

3. Security of Personal Wallets

If a gamer chooses to use a non-custodial or high-privacy site, they are accountable for their own wallet security. The Future of the Industry

The trajectory of the cryptocurrency casino market is pointed towards complete integration with Web3 technology. We are currently seeing the introduction of "decentralized casinos" (dApps), where there is no main operator-- only clever agreements. In these environments, the neighborhood typically governs the platform through Decentralized Autonomous Organizations (DAOs), and a part of your house "edge" is rearranged back to the token holders.

As global regulations capture up to the technology, the difference between a "crypto casino" and a "traditional casino" will likely disappear, with recognized institutional brands adopting blockchain for their backend operations to increase effectiveness and trust.
